Three Owls shine in second annual KSU Pro Day
The Kennesaw State Owls held their second annual Pro Day at the Perch at the KSU Sports and Entertainment Park on Friday. A number of players from Division I FCS, Division II, Division III and NAIA schools in the area took park in the invitation-only event, but all eyes were one KSU standout Derrick Farrow, Dante Blackmon and Chaston Bennett.

And here are the Pro Day results for Farrow and Blackmon (we don’t have Bennett’s results at this time).
Derrick Farrow – 5097 200 8 1/4 hands, 30 1/2 arms, 73 1/8 WS, 20 BP, 34.5 Vert, 9’9 BJ, 4.58 forty

Dante Blackmon – Kennesaw State University – 5104 193 91/2 hands, 30 3/4 Arms, 74 1/2 WS, BP 16, Vert 34.5, BJ 9’11, 4.53 40

Farrow finished the 2016 season with 47 tackles, one interception and one forced fumble, and his play led to him being named to the All-Big South Second Team. Blackmon was named to the All-Big South First Team after finishing the year with 19 tackles, seven passes defended and six interceptions. Bennett was also named to the All-Big South First Team after recording 672 rushing yards, 315 receiving yards and 14 total touchdowns.
The NFL Draft will be held April 27-29 in Philadelphia.
